5P49EE601NLGI8: Clock/Timing - Clock Generators, PLLs, Frequency Synthesizers The 5P49EE601NLGI8 is a clock/timing integrated circuit (IC) designed for use in clock generators, phase-locked loops (PLLs), and frequency synthesizers. This device is optimized for providing accurate timing signals in telecommunication applications, such as optical and microwave communication systems. It is ideal for use in applications that require highly accurate frequency synthesizers as well as high-frequency clock signals.Application FieldThe 5P49EE601NLGI8 is designed for use in a wide range of clock/timing applications including clock synthesis and frequency multiplication. The device is well-suited for use in mobile and radio telecommunication systems, wireless networks, audio systems, and other embedded systems that require an accurate timing signal. It can also be used in optical telecommunication systems to accurately generate the high frequency local oscillation signal.In addition to these applications, the 5P49EE601NLGI8 is also suited for use in automotive and industrial embedded systems, such as automation and instrumentation, where timing accuracy is important.
